Radu Miruță, the interim Minister of Transport, announced urgent measures for Metrorex, emphasizing that the company's problems can no longer be ignored. He convened the General Assembly of Shareholders (AGA) to discuss essential topics, including the review of costly security and cleaning contracts, the recovery of uncollected penalties, and the legalization of activities at the Ciurel depot.
Miruță highlighted alarming figures, such as millions in uncollected penalties and delays in construction sites, stressing that Bucharest residents are paying more for lower quality services. He also announced that the metro ticket will not increase in price, contrary to previous decisions. The minister mentioned that he found 60 million euros uncollected from penalties for a single contract, emphasizing the need to transform Metrorex into an entity that serves citizens, not interest groups.
